Creating a Supportive Community
One of the primary ways in which old age homes can be transformative is by fostering a sense of community. Many seniors experience loneliness and isolation, especially if they live alone or have lost loved ones. An old age home in Mumbai can provide the opportunity for seniors to connect with others in a similar life stage, allowing them to share experiences and build meaningful relationships.
By encouraging social activities, group gatherings, and communal dining, these homes create a network of support for elderly individuals. Whether it’s sharing stories with fellow residents, playing games, or simply enjoying each other’s company, these social interactions can significantly improve emotional well-being. Feeling a sense of belonging is crucial for mental health, and in old age homes, seniors often find new friendships and connections that reduce feelings of loneliness and depression.
Health and Wellness Support
Old age homes are designed to offer tailored healthcare services that ensure the physical well-being of residents. In an old age home in Mumbai, seniors can benefit from regular medical check-ups, physical therapy, and assistance with managing chronic conditions. With specialized care available around the clock, elderly individuals are less likely to experience medical emergencies without help, providing peace of mind to both residents and their families.
In addition to medical care, many old age homes also prioritize fitness and wellness. They provide activities such as yoga, Tai Chi, and walking groups that are designed specifically for older adults. These activities promote not only physical health but also mental clarity and emotional resilience. Regular physical activity can help prevent mobility issues, boost immunity, and improve mood, all of which are essential for seniors living in an old age home in Mumbai.

Safe and Comfortable Living Spaces
The design of an old age home in Mumbai plays a crucial role in ensuring the comfort and safety of its residents. Modern facilities are equipped with features that address the specific needs of older adults. From wheelchair accessibility to non-slip floors, these spaces are carefully designed to prevent accidents and make everyday tasks easier for seniors.
In addition to safety, these homes also focus on creating environments that feel welcoming and comfortable. Many old age homes in Mumbai offer cozy, private rooms where residents can relax, decorate, and enjoy their personal space. Common areas such as gardens, lounges, and dining rooms are designed to foster interaction and community, while still offering moments of peace and privacy when needed. These thoughtfully designed spaces can significantly improve the quality of life for residents, providing a sense of security, comfort, and warmth.
Spiritual and Emotional Well-being
For many seniors, spirituality plays an important role in their lives. An old age home in Mumbai can provide an environment where seniors can continue their spiritual practices, whether it’s attending religious services, meditation, or simply reflecting in peace. Many old age homes incorporate spaces for prayer and reflection, where residents can connect with their inner selves and with their faith.
In addition to spiritual well-being, emotional support is another key component of transformative care. Most old age homes offer counseling services and opportunities for seniors to engage in therapeutic activities such as art therapy, group discussions, or reminiscence therapy. These activities help residents process their emotions, reflect on their lives, and find joy in their experiences. By providing a holistic approach to emotional and spiritual well-being, old age homes ensure that seniors feel respected, valued, and cared for in every aspect of their lives.
